The best decision I've made this summer was to get rid of my concrete tile roof and replace it with a Northgate composition roof. I got tired of my leaky concrete tile roof which costed thousands just to maintain and replace the tiles! It was so brittle that only a concrete tile roofer knew how to walk on it. The 2nd best decision was choosing Larry Haight's Roofing to do the demolition and install. I was blown away at how efficient, hard-working, and professional the crew was. I have a large roof and the temp was in the 90's. They started everyday around 8am and cleaned up by 7 pm. The job was done in about a week. The supervisor Mike came by every day to check in with me and inspect the work. The roofing supervisor was great in answering all my questions. The gutter guy came right after the roof was completed and took another 3 days to complete. I love my new roof and it looks gorgeous! Anyone can walk on it without worrying about breaking my tiles. The best news is that I won't have to worry about a leaky roof this winter. If anything goes wrong, Larry Haight's Roofing will come out for free to repair it. They weren't the cheapest bid but absolutely the best!
